Congratulations on being accepted to CNR. It's a great school. My advice to you is to study, study, study some more. Make sure to read your books ahead of time to keep up with the workload. Also make sure when you complete your first med-surg, apply for an internship/externship because that's a guarantee to getting your foot in the door. Choose a hospital that you really want to work at and also apply to many facilities not just one. The tuition for CNR is expensive because it is a private institution. Per semester I was paying $12,000+, equaling my tuition to about $24,000 per year. I never room and boarded at CNR because I lived 15 minutes away. So I'm guessing with the scholarship you received, it would be $4000 per semester. Hope this helps. Let me know if you have anymore questions.
